Output 62dd988c35f5b3a66cf802093d4f8c777f8436b5f7b2260bdff268c61ab16d5f:0

value
1347836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bdff2ce7b1f788940d61930c8ab3a9168d4b34a OP_EQUAL
address
3BXQWHHcYZrpkLEkoAHdJNrKUqNE4oiZEV
transaction
62dd988c35f5b3a66cf802093d4f8c777f8436b5f7b2260bdff268c61ab16d5f
spent
true